About This Property

Unmatched value and family friendly living atop breathtaking Burnaby Mountain, almost $200k BELOW assessment! With over 1900 square ft of indoor + outdoor living, this south-facing CORNER UNIT is the largest 3 BED townhome in the complex, featuring 3 FULL BATHS, 2 PARKING SPACES + Level 2 EV charger, STORAGE LOCKER and your own 529 square ft ROOFTOP DECK…
